How Indira Gandhi Institute of Technology (IGIT), Sarang converts CGPA to percentage
Indira Gandhi Institute of Technology (IGIT), Sarang (Odisha) uses the formula % = (CGPA − 0.50) × 10 to convert a 10-point CGPA into a percentage for transcripts, job applications and higher studies. Enter your CGPA above to convert it instantly.
Worked example
Take a CGPA of 8 on the 10-point scale. Applying the official Indira Gandhi Institute of Technology (IGIT), Sarang formula % = (CGPA − 0.50) × 10 gives a percentage of about 75%. Why the formula matters
It's tempting to assume CGPA × 10 everywhere, but that's only right for some universities. Indira Gandhi Institute of Technology (IGIT), Sarang uses % = (CGPA − 0.50) × 10, so a generic multiplier would give a different — and wrong — number on your application. Using the official conversion is what keeps your percentage defensible if an admissions office or employer asks how you calculated it.
